A: It’s not uncommon for painters to request a down payment of 20 to 30 percent of a job’s total cost. Local or state regulations may limit the amount allowed for a down payment, so check the rules before starting contract work. Typically, after you’ve made the down payment, you won’t pay again until the job is done.

How Much Do Painters Charge per Hour? A professional painter typically charges between $25 and $100 per hour. The cost will vary based on the painter’s experience, the difficulty of the job and where the location is, according to Angie’s List.

But such new beginnings cost real money. Professional painters charge around $4,000 for labor and materials to paint the exterior of a 2,500-square-foot, two-story home and roughly $5,500 for the interior. Painters’ rates may range from $20 to $60 an hour, but around $40 is typical in urban areas.

How much should you pay a painter per day?

How Much Do Painters Charge Per Day? Painters typically charge $200 to $500 per day, depending on their skill and productivity levels. When repainting a room or house, a painter’s day rate may cover 150 to 350 square feet of paintable area per hour, with the average professional working 8-hours per day.

How do you estimate exterior painting?

Average Cost to Paint a House Exterior. Painting an average home between 1,500 and 2,500 square feet can cost between $1,000 and $6,000. Professionals provide estimates primarily based on the area of walls or siding they will paint, not the home’s square footage.

How do you calculate square footage for exterior painting?

The first part is easy. Measure the perimeter of your house (the distance around it) – the main part, not including porches or other appendages. Then, multiply that number by the height, and you have the square footage (the area to be painted).

How much do painters charge per square foot exterior?

The current average cost to paint a house exterior is $2.50-$4 per square foot. To paint the interior, the average cost is $1.50-$3 per square foot. These prices are contingent on the market in your area and what the features of your home are.

How much should I charge for my acrylic paintings?

Charge by the square inch To work out your price by the square inch, multiply the length by the width of your painting. For example, an 8 by 8 inch piece = 8 x 8 = 64 square inches. If you charge $1 per square inch, this would be $64 + the price of materials if you are adding that as well.

How much does it cost to paint a room UK 2020?

On average painting and decorating prices are around £160 per day. Prices in London are likely to be a little higher. This means you should expect to pay between £375 and £500 to paint an average size room. You may get it a little cheaper if you have a bigger job.
